This newly created project arises in response to the demands of professionals who assist immigrant and refugee communities, as well as the need identified by the young people of Migraespai, who point out the difficulty of settling into a new city and knowing the different existing resources.

In this sense, the volunteer program aims to accompany newcomers to the city in managing tasks such as going to City Hall, visiting the doctor, translating documents, and facilitating the acculturation process (popular festivals, learning Catalan and Spanish, how the transport system works, neighborhoods, etc.), among others.

At the same time, a supportive relationship is established with the volunteer referent to advise and accompany the person through this adaptation process, which we know is longer than the support services can sustain.

At a later stage, it is proposed that the same people who have received help can accompany others arriving in the city, thus increasing the group of volunteers and creating a mutual aid network.

In order to build this network and allow the group to deploy its own resources, meeting spaces will be created for both volunteer companions and users of the resource. This will be a space for accompaniment for everyone and for the exchange of experiences, information, and cultures.

The Foundation will manage the volunteers consisting of the Migraespai working group and interested individuals from the Board of Trustees and Friends of the Foundation, as well as other supporters who wish to join.

This program has just received support from the Barcelona City Council.
